All Passion Spent (1986)
Synopsis
Lady Slane, the wife of a recently deceased politician, retreats to a cottage in the countryside. In the process, she must attempt to discard her old public profile and find a new way of living.

Wendy Hiller stars as a recently widowed woman who intends to relish her newfound freedom, in an adaptation of Vita Sackville-West's classic story.

Ep. 1: Episode 1
Lord Slane is dead. After a lifetime spent supporting his career as Viceroy of India, Prime Minister and elder statesman, Lady Slane is free at last to do as she pleases. Downstairs her children are busily deciding her future, assuming gracious compliance but Lady Slane plans to reassert her independence.
-
Ep. 2: Episode 2
Lady Slane has escaped the clutches of her family. Now the tenant of Mr Bucktrout's house at Hampstead, she sets about creating a new home for herself and Genoux. An unexpected visitor, however, disturbs the calm by confronting Lady Slane with the errors of her past.
-
Ep. 3: Episode 3
After more than half a century as a dutiful and loving wife, Lady Slane revels in the company of her new-found friends. But FitzGeorge has one last surprise in store for her, leaving a problem which only she can resolve.
